The core argument in the sleep number vs purple mattress debate boils down to active adaptability versus passive response. Sleep Number beds are built around adjustable vulcanized rubber air chambers controlled by a pneumatic pump. This allows you to digitally dial in your exact firmness level (your “Sleep Number”) on a scale from 1 to 100. Purple, on the other hand, rejects air pumps in favor of a materials science marvel: a hyper-elastic polymer molded into a geometric grid (the GelFlex Grid). It dynamically buckles under heavy pressure points like your shoulders and hips while supporting lighter areas like your lower back.
Quick Comparison Matrix
| Feature | Sleep Number (Smart Series) | Purple Mattress (GelFlex Grid) |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Material | Air Chambers with Polyfoam comfort layers | Hyper-Elastic GelFlex Polymer Grid & Pocketed Coils |
| Firmness Adjustability | Active (1 to 100 via remote/app) | Passive, instantaneous response based on pressure |
| Temperature Regulation | Moderate (Dependent on specific foam layers) | Excellent (Open-air grid allows massive heat dissipation) |
| Built-in Biometrics | Yes (SleepIQ active ballistocardiography tracking) | No (Pure physical design, no active tech) |
| Durability | High, but mechanical components can wear out | Very high polymer structure; does not sag over time |

Setting up a Sleep Number bed involves managing hoses, pump boxes, and syncing your mattress to your Wi-Fi network. Once configured, the real-world benefit is highly palpable for couples who disagree on firmness. If you prefer a feather-soft cloud and your partner prefers a stiff floor, a dual-chamber Sleep Number can satisfy both needs perfectly.
Conversely, unboxing a Purple mattress is a simple physical effort. It is heavy, cumbersome, and has a distinct elastic feel that surprises first-time buyers. When you lie down, you do not sink like memory foam, nor do you feel pushed back like traditional inner-springs. Instead, you float. This unique tactile feedback makes the sleep number vs purple mattress decision highly dependent on whether you enjoy a floating, springy sensation or the deep, highly tailored nesting experience of customized air pressure.

Analyzing the Comfort & Support Profiles of Purple vs Sleep Number
To fully resolve your sleep quality struggles, we must investigate how our sleep number vs purple mattress comparison performs at a physiological level. Let’s look at spinal alignment. Proper sleep health requires your spine to maintain its natural curvature, whether you sleep on your side, back, or stomach. If a mattress is too soft, your pelvis will sag, creating a stressful lateral curve. If it is too firm, your shoulder will be forced upward, straining your cervical spine.
When you analyze an unbiased purple vs sleep number analysis, the distinction in pressure management becomes clear. Sleep Number beds allow you to adjust the volume of air inside the internal chambers, but the air bladder behaves in a highly uniform way. If you set the mattress to a firmer setting to keep your lower back supported, the pressure against your protruding shoulders and hips naturally increases. This can occasionally cause small pressure points, which triggers tossing and turning throughout the night, throwing you out of deep sleep.
Purple, using its patented GelFlex Grid, manages pressure in a vastly different manner. Under lightweight parts of your body, the grid walls stand strong, providing support. When heavy pressure points like your hip bone press against it, the underlying grid columns selectively collapse, dispersing the weight outwards. This reduces localized capillary pressure, maintaining steady blood flow and decreasing those irritating 3 AM awakenings. For hot sleepers, the empty columns of the Purple grid allow heat to escape, a key feature for lowering core body temperature to initiate deep, restorative sleep.
However, the ultimate sleep number vs purple mattress breakdown reveals that Sleep Number holds a significant advantage for couples with disparate body weights. If one partner weighs 130 lbs and the other weighs 240 lbs, a static mattress can struggle to support both partners optimally. The dual-chamber Sleep Number allows each partner to choose their own level of support. The larger sleeper can choose a higher number (e.g., 65) to prevent sinking, while the lighter sleeper can choose a lower number (e.g., 35) to enjoy gentle pressure relief.

Which Mattress is Right For You?
When weighing purple vs sleep number, the ideal choice depends on your lifestyle and physical needs:
- Choose Sleep Number if: You and your partner have vastly different body types, prefer highly specific adjustable firmness, or suffer from dynamic, changing back pain that requires daily adjustments.
- Choose Purple if: You sleep hot, prefer a highly responsive, springy, floating sensation, and want a simple, mechanical mattress design without active electronic components.
